]> git.sesse.net Git - vlc/blobdiff - modules/video_output/msw/direct3d.c
Avoid ?: GCC-ism
[vlc] / modules / video_output / msw / direct3d.c
index dcb73107bca90fae92ccb8f68b848d847169beb4..6435154de92ad388439666af3a9666aa4794bc28 100644 (file)
@@ -1031,7 +1031,8 @@ static int Direct3DVoutCreatePictures( vout_thread_t *p_vout, size_t i_num_pics
     HRESULT hr;
     size_t c;
     // if vout is already running, use current chroma, otherwise choose from upstream
-    int i_chroma = p_vout->output.i_chroma ? : p_vout->render.i_chroma;
+    int i_chroma = p_vout->output.i_chroma ? p_vout->output.i_chroma
+                                           : p_vout->render.i_chroma;
 
     I_OUTPUTPICTURES = 0;